The Cellar Door
Nestled in the heart of the city, The Cellar Door is a true treasure. It’s the kind of place that feels both timeless and utterly contemporary. Housed in a historic building, the ambiance is warm and inviting, with exposed brickwork and intimate lighting. They pride themselves on their extensive gin selection, but their cocktail menu is where they truly shine. Expect expertly mixed classics alongside some inventive house specials. The staff are knowledgeable and passionate, always happy to guide you through their offerings or even create something bespoke if you have a particular craving. It’s a fantastic spot for a pre-dinner drink or a relaxed evening catching up with friends. Their attention to detail, from the quality of the spirits to the garnishes, is evident in every drink. Don’t miss their take on a Negroni – it’s a masterclass in balance.
Fermain Lounge
Located along the picturesque riverside, Fermain Lounge offers a more contemporary feel with stunning views. While it’s known for its relaxed atmosphere and excellent wine list, their cocktail game is surprisingly strong. They tend to favour fresh, seasonal ingredients, and their signature cocktails often incorporate local flavours, giving them a unique Durham twist. The outdoor seating area, weather permitting, is an absolute delight, offering a perfect vantage point to watch the world go by. Inside, the decor is modern and chic, making it a stylish choice for an evening out. They do a mean Espresso Martini, and their Passionfruit Bellini is a refreshing choice on a sunny afternoon.

The Old Tom’s Bar (at The Three Horseshoes Inn)
This is a true hidden gem, located just a short drive from the city centre in the charming village of Bowishall. The Old Tom’s Bar is part of The Three Horseshoes Inn, but it operates with its own distinct personality. It’s a place that celebrates the craft of cocktail making with a focus on artisanal spirits and creative concoctions. The atmosphere is intimate and unpretentious, with a real passion for quality evident in every aspect. Their cocktail menu changes seasonally, reflecting the best produce available. You might find intriguing combinations like a Smoked Rosemary Old Fashioned or a Lavender and Honey Sour. This is the place to go if you want to be surprised and delighted by your drink. It’s worth the short journey out of town to experience this level of dedication to mixology. Check their social media for their latest creations, as they love to showcase their new seasonal offerings.
Venn Cafe
Venn Cafe, situated in the heart of Durham, has carved out a niche for itself with its vibrant atmosphere and a cocktail menu that’s both exciting and accessible. They offer a fantastic range of classic cocktails, but it’s their signature creations that really capture the imagination. Think playful names, bold flavours, and Instagram-worthy presentations. They’re particularly known for their dedication to using high-quality ingredients and their bartenders are always happy to chat about the inspiration behind each drink. It’s a lively spot, perfect for a fun night out with friends, and they often have music playing, adding to the energetic vibe. Their ‘Durham Fog’ cocktail, a creamy, spiced concoction, is a must-try. It’s a testament to their ability to blend comfort with sophistication.

21. Market Place (The Restaurant Bar)
While primarily known as a highly regarded restaurant, the bar at 21. Market Place deserves a special mention. It’s an elegant space that offers a more sophisticated drinking experience. The cocktail menu here is curated with the same attention to detail as their food menu. Expect expertly prepared classics and a selection of thoughtfully designed signature drinks. The bar staff are highly professional, offering impeccable service. It’s the ideal place for a pre-theatre drink if you’re catching a show at the nearby Gala Theatre, or for a quiet, celebratory drink with someone special. The ambiance is refined, making it a perfect escape from the hustle and bustle.
Insider Tips for Your Durham Cocktail Journey
Navigating Durham’s bar scene is part of the adventure. Here are a few tips from a local to make your experience even better:
- Book Ahead, Especially on Weekends: Durham is a popular destination, and many of these smaller, highly-regarded bars can get very busy, particularly on Friday and Saturday nights. Booking a table is always a wise move to avoid disappointment.
- Explore Beyond the Obvious: While the city centre has fantastic options, don’t be afraid to venture slightly out. As I mentioned, The Old Tom’s Bar offers a unique experience that’s well worth the short taxi ride.
- Talk to Your Bartender: The people behind the bar are often the most knowledgeable about the drinks. If you’re unsure what to order, tell them your preferences (sweet, sour, spirit base, etc.), and they’ll likely recommend something you’ll love. Many are passionate about their craft and happy to share their expertise.
- Check for Special Events: Keep an eye on the social media pages of your chosen bars. Many host tasting events, guest bartender nights, or offer special menus for holidays and local festivals. This is a great way to discover new drinks and enjoy a unique atmosphere.
